fuse links???

where are the fuse links located. i am tracing the wiring in my yota to find why the motor isnt charging itself. i have replaced alternator, voltage regulator and battery and it still wont charge itself??????i need help

actually .. " fuse links " on the 79-83 are right off the positive post of the battery 2 of them .. 1 single fuse link and 1 double fuse link .. green ends and factory clip right onto the positive cable end .

then there is a fuse box , with fuses .....
